V. Mertz (wine cellar) ★ 4.7

Wine bar$$$Old MarketTue-Sun 17:30-close; Mon closed

V. Mertz's 450-bottle wine cellar in the Old Market Passageway holds a Wine Spectator Award of Excellence, with sommelier-led pairings for its tasting menus.

Signature pour: Sommelier-chosen pairing for the eight-course Grand Tasting menu

Wine focus: Wine Spectator Award-winning cellar, 450+ bottles

Food: Five and eight-course tasting menu

La Buvette ★ 4.4

Wine bar$$Old MarketMon-Thu 10:00-22:00; Fri 10:00-23:00; Sat 09:00-23:00; Sun 11:30-21:00

La Buvette is the Old Market's most wine-forward stop, combining a merchant retail shelf of natural and small-producer bottles with a French rotating kitchen.

Signature pour: Natural French or Loire Valley white, by the glass or bottle

Wine focus: Natural and small-producer wines, French-led

Food: Daily French rotating specials, cheese counter

Barroco Wine Bar ★ 4.0

Wine bar$$West OmahaMon 15:00-23:00; Tue-Thu 11:00-23:00; Fri 11:00-00:00; Sat 13:00-00:00; Sun 13:00-20:00

Barroco Wine Bar in West Omaha focuses on Spanish and South American wine with a tapas programme, bringing a European wine bar model to the Omaha suburbs.

Signature pour: Spanish Rioja or Tempranillo by the glass

Wine focus: Spanish and South American wines with tapas food programme

Food: Tapas and charcuterie boards
